Structural basis for (p)ppGpp synthesis by the Staphylococcus aureus small alarmone synthetase RelP

The stringent response is a global reprogramming of bacterial physiology that renders cells more tolerant to antibiotics and induces virulence gene expression in pathogens in response to stress.
